Clinical evaluation of glass-ionomer cement restorations.

Martin John Tyas1.   

Abstract

This article mentions the general structure, properties and clinical performance of conventional and resin-modified glass-ionomer cements, focusing on adhesion, caries inhibition effect and recommendations of their use.
